GOLF
MEDAL MATCH. Leaders in the Feilding Coif Club’s medal match on Saturday wero It. I’. Stevenson and P. C. Miies (A grade), L. Turner, P. B. Desmond and D. Smith (B grade). Stevenson won the A grade with a net 66 and Turner the B grade with a net 64. Several' handicaps arc to be adjusted. Details are :—• '. ; c A grade. —It. P, Stevenson, 82—16 66; P. 0.
